Transaction 1b65ae6311cfaeaa8324003f01b07424de5b3cc767cc30812a2592018b8bb0ac
1 Input
1 Output
-
1b65ae6311cfaeaa8324003f01b07424de5b3cc767cc30812a2592018b8bb0ac:0
- value
- 1090540
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daadf63099b4ba452e4c8b4ff1808834b35c6f9e OP_EQUAL
- address
- 3MdHdS212eafAsfZVsLzj6EFCMufJ5PeVB